We developed Hisab Kitab, a user-friendly financial settlement app for a client. This innovative solution simplifies expense sharing and debt settlement among friends, roommates, and groups.
Challenges During The Project Time
Our team tackled complex challenges in creating Hisab Kitab. Implementing a precise expense-splitting algorithm for various scenarios demanded meticulous attention to detail. Ensuring real-time synchronization across devices posed significant technical hurdles. Balancing user privacy with social features required careful consideration. We overcame these obstacles through innovative problem-solving and rigorous testing.
- Designing an intuitive interface for complex financial interactions
- Implementing a precise and fair expense-splitting algorithm
- Ensuring real-time synchronization across multiple devices and platforms
- Integrating secure payment gateways for multiple currencies
- Optimizing performance for quick calculations with large group sizes
- Developing a smart debt simplification system to minimize transactions
Technologies and Frameworks Used
SettleUp leverages cutting-edge technologies for optimal performance. The front end utilizes React Native for cross-platform compatibility. Our robust backend is powered by Node.js and Express.js, with MongoDB handling data management. We implemented Socket.IO for real-time updates and MongoDB Realm for offline data synchronization and used AWS services for scalable cloud hosting. Stripe integration enables secure in-app transactions, while Firebase handles push notifications.
Timeline and Unique Features
We completed this project in 2 months, delivering a feature-rich app that streamlines group finances. Unique features include smart debt simplification algorithms, currency conversion for international groups, and customizable expense categories. The app also offers insightful spending analytics and seamless integration with popular payment platforms, setting Hisab Kitab apart in the financial tech landscape